l have shown the record diskovith two safety grooves 7 and it. These YIQDVBS are produeed in the manufacture oft 1e disk and define the spare on which the spiral record groove is to he. impressed. But one of the safety grooves.that at the end of the reeord groo\ e,is neeessary to the operation of the deviee. hut as in disks turned out by some manirfaeturers. have the record groove heginning at the inside and working out ward, and others ha re. the groove lieginning at the. outside. and'working in, I prefer to have the two safety grooves in the disk, so that it ran he used with either style of record groove. it. will he understood that. the invention may he earried out without the use of the safety groove. for the reason that without the safetygroove, when the stylus re'aehes the end of thereeord groove. it will run upon the [lat surface of disk, and the feed of the tone-arm will ('ease.

As the tonearin 9 and yoke 24 are fed acrow the line of the spiral record groove by the engagement of the stylus with the recordgroove, the frictional engagement of the slide 25 with the yoke will move it, the slide, in the direction of the travel of the tone-arm, and the slide will engage the swinging arm and cause it to swing in the same direction. The slide 29 will be moved against the tension of its spring 29 at each revolution of the cam 21, and the V shaped notch 30 in its end will engage the pin 27 and swing 'the arm, and .with it the slide, back to the central position of the arm. As soon as the greater diameter of the cam 21 leaves the end of the slide, the latter, under the influence of its spring. will 'recede from its point of engagement with the pin- 27, and the swinging arm will be swung to one side by the frictional engagement of the slide with yoke. The high part of the cam 22 will now engage the finger 32, and move the projection 33 toward the end of the swinging arm, the path of the projection being in line with the central position of the arm, but as the arm has been swung to one side, the projection will not engage it.
